    TV personality, Ahmed Isah slaps a woman on live Tv for setting a child’s hair on fire (Video)

    simpleBy simpleMay 19, 2021No Comments1 Min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Copy Link

    Human rights activist and TV media personality, Ahmed Isah, known as Ordinary President trends on Twitter for slapping a lady on live TV during an interview.

    According to reports, it is alleged that the woman set her child’s hair on fire over witchcraft allegations. She was said to have tied the girl’s hands and legs, poured kerosene on her head, and ignited the fire. The child was burnt alive, although the child didn’t die, sustained severe damage.

    Ahmed Isah who hosts a program titled, “Berekete Family” and offers ordinary citizens the opportunity to tell their stories, used his platform to interview the woman.

    During the question and answer session, the woman had given an adamant response that further got him angry as he lost his cool and gave her two resounding slaps live on TV.
